At Advanced Robot Solutions (ARS), we see it every day. Citizens walk into buildings unsure where to go or what they need. They visit court websites and struggle to find clear answers. Staff, in turn, spend hours handling the same repetitive questions, creating bottlenecks that slow down service for everyone. The issue isn’t a lack of effort. It’s that access to information and services hasn’t been designed around how people navigate courts today.

That’s why everything we build is centered around three core pillars: expand public access, increase operational efficiency, and ensure systems are safe, secure, and compliant.
Expand Public Access by meeting people where they are.
Access shouldn’t depend on knowing the right office, standing in the right line, or visiting during business hours. ARS Digital Assistants provide 24/7 support online, giving citizens immediate answers to common questions and guiding them to the correct next step. Inside the courthouse, Mobile Access Points extend that same experience into the physical environment. With a quick scan, visitors can pull up hearing dockets, get step-by-step directions, or find payment options. This creates a consistent, guided experience across both digital and in-person touchpoints, reducing confusion and empowering citizens to move forward with confidence.
Increase Operational Efficiency by reducing repetitive work.
Court staff are often stretched thin, not because of complex issues, but because of volume. Simple, repeatable questions consume a disproportionate amount of time. ARS solutions help offload that demand by automating routine interactions and providing self-service pathways. This doesn’t replace staff. It allows them to focus on higher-value responsibilities that require human judgment and care. At the same time, leadership gains visibility into usage trends and common inquiries, helping identify gaps in communication and opportunities to further streamline operations.
